IP address 203.200.12.150 lookup, whois and location finder

IP address  203.200.12.150
203.200.12.150  India
IPv4
203.200.12.150
TATA Communications
Ing Vysya Bank Ltd
203.200.12.0 - 203.200.13.255
Asia/Kolkata (UTC+5.5)
India 
not determined
not determined
20, 77
Show
Connection type dial-up
IP on map